New Washington has enjoyed a three-game homestand but will soon have to dust off their road jerseys. They will face off against the Southwestern Rebels at 10:00 a.m. on Saturday. Given that both teams suffered a loss in their last game, they both have a little extra motivation heading into this matchup.
New Washington lost 10-4 to South Ripley on Friday.
Meanwhile, Wednesday just wasn't the day for Southwestern's offense. They fell just short of Rising Sun by a score of 2-0 on Wednesday. Having soared to a lofty 18 runs in the game before, Southwestern's shutout was a dramatic turnaround.
Ashley Fulton sp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ered two runs (both of which were unearned) on one hit. She has been nothing but reliable: she hasn't pitched less than five innings in eight consecutive pitching appearances.
New Washington's defeat dropped their record down to 6-9. As for Southwestern, their loss dropped their record down to 11-5.
New Washington might still be hurting after the 11-5 defeat they got from Southwestern when the teams last played back in March. A big factor in that loss was the dominant performance of Fulton, who struck out 13 batters over seven innings while giving up four earned (and one unearned) runs off six hits.
